The only bi-annual Magazine for Architectural Entertainment.

PIN-UP is a magazine that captures an architectural spirit, rather than focusing on technical details of design, by featuring interviews with architects, designers, and artists, and presenting work as an informal work in progress & a fun assembly of ideas, stories and conversations, all paired with cutting-edge photography and artwork.

A new issue sees the team at the ‘magazine for architectural entertainment’ draw once again from their playful bag of print tricks; this is the one-off ‘Big Design’ edition, reimagined in XXL format for maximum impact.

On the theme, editor Felix Burrichter writes: ‘This XXL issue of PIN-UP is not just supersized—it is also an expansion of how we think about design. Because in a time of too much, it’s not about having less—it’s about holding on to what matters most.’

Featuring interviews with Faye Toogood, Mark Grattan, Michael Anastassiades and Alexis Sablone, a brief history of Pierre Paulin’s oeuvre as his iconic F300 chair is reissued, a lineup of 11 creative forces currently shaping New York’s design landscape, a sprawling portfolio of outdoor furniture design, and a special feature by Michael Bullock on how ‘the late Colombian artist Juan Pablo Echeverri transformed his Bogotá apartment into a work of art.’

Details:

  • 300 x 385 mm, 96 pages - clear plastic cover included 
  • New York, US
  • Biannual
  • Creative and editorial director: Felix Burrichter
  • Art director and designer: Office Ben Ganz
